diff --git a/src/tools/bfs_shell/Jamfile b/src/tools/bfs_shell/Jamfile index c9d15ac9dc..83fbf51cbd 100644 --- a/src/tools/bfs_shell/Jamfile +++ b/src/tools/bfs_shell/Jamfile @@ -48,18 +48,21 @@ local bfsSource = kernel_interface.cpp ; +BuildPlatformMergeObject bfs.o : $(bfsSource) ; + BuildPlatformMain bfs_shell : - $(bfsSource) - - : fs_shell.a $(libHaikuCompat) $(HOST_LIBSUPC++) $(HOST_LIBSTDC++) - $(HOST_LIBROOT) $(fsShellCommandLibs) + : + bfs.o + fs_shell.a $(libHaikuCompat) $(HOST_LIBSUPC++) $(HOST_LIBSTDC++) + $(HOST_LIBROOT) $(fsShellCommandLibs) ; BuildPlatformMain bfs_fuse : - $(bfsSource) - - : fuse_module.a $(libHaikuCompat) $(HOST_LIBSUPC++) $(HOST_LIBSTDC++) - $(HOST_STATIC_LIBROOT) $(fsShellCommandLibs) fuse + : + bfs.o + fuse_module.a + $(libHaikuCompat) $(HOST_LIBSUPC++) $(HOST_LIBSTDC++) + $(HOST_STATIC_LIBROOT) $(fsShellCommandLibs) fuse ;